The Story

William Hansen served in the United States Marine Corps from 1986 through 1996. During his career, he served in Infantry, Anti-Tank, and Embassy Security assignments.

His service took him to Norway, Kuwait, Saudi Arabia, and Somalia. He served during Operation Desert Storm and Operation Restore Hope, carrying forward a family tradition of military service that had already endured for generations.

A Life Across Missions

Military Tradition

Hansen was raised in a family whose history of combat service extended across generations, creating both an example to follow and a legacy to carry forward.

United States Marine Corps

From 1986 through 1996, Hansen served in Infantry, Anti-Tank, and Embassy Security roles, developing the discipline and identity that would remain with him long after active service.

Combat and Overseas Service

His service included deployments to Norway, Kuwait, Saudi Arabia, and Somalia, including service during Operation Desert Storm and Operation Restore Hope.

Life After the Uniform

The years following military service brought new missions and new challenges, including work as a contractor and a life-changing injury in January 2009 after completing an extended mission.
